Overview

The Meetings Associate organizes and implements meetings logistics for AACR’s meetings, conferences, workshops, and the Annual Meeting to provide support to a Meetings Manager. Additional functions include, but are not limited to, registration and housing processing, final bill reconciliation, hotel, venue and vendor request for proposals, on-site meeting support, shipping, badge creation and overall meeting setup responsibilities.

 

Responsibilities

  • Prepares the final reconciliation of payments due to vendors and hotels at the end of meetings, conferences, and workshops under the guidance of a meetings or senior meetings manager.
  • Assists in the preparation of budgets for meetings, conferences, and workshops.
  • Creates events and manages registrations through Salesforce.
  • Solicits services from vendors through the RFP process.
  • Provides administrative support to the senior leadership of the Meetings and Exhibits Department.
  • Supports the Vice President, Senior Director of Meetings, Director of Exhibits, Senior Meetings Managers and Meetings Managers with work related to Special Conferences, Workshops, and the Annual Meeting.
  • Provides additional support as needed at the convention center and/or hotels for the Annual Meeting.
  • Coordinates the registration and housing for meetings, workshops, and conference attendees, as assigned.
  • Assists in the development of systems to manage registration and housing effectively and accurately though.
  • Assists with participant travel arrangements, as required.
  • Assist with travel arrangements for VIPs of assigned meetings as needed.
  • Prepares appropriate correspondence, as needed.
  • Coordinates speaker logistics and sends confirmation letters.
  • Travels on-site with Directors and/or Meeting Managers to handle registration, housing assistance, meeting logistics, and overall meeting management support, as assigned.
  • Aids attendees and speakers with their meeting, workshop, and conference needs.
  • Assists in the planning and execution of in-house meetings and events in the AACR Conference Center, as assigned.
  • Assists in creating and maintaining timelines for all meetings, special conferences, workshops, and the Annual Meeting.
  • Acts as liaison between the Meetings & Exhibits Department and all other AACR departments.
  • Assists in the preparation of post-meeting reports.
  • Performs the essential functions of the position, and other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• 1-2 years experience in meeting planning and/or registration.
  • Excellent writing and verbal communication skills.
  • Excellent critical thinking and problem-solving skills.
  • Flexible and versatile.
  • Excellent organizational skills, attention to detail and the ability to multi-task.
  • Strong time management skills.
  • Ability to maintain high level of professionalism with AACR members and co-workers.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ills.
  • Willingness to work extra hours during conferences and peak periods.
  • 35% travel required.

Education and Training:

  • BA or BS degree required

Computer Knowledge:

  • Proficiency in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Ability to learn and use Salesforce and other membership and registration systems utilized by the Meetings & Exhibits Department.
